the sonic impact is quite good. it sounds very clear, detailed and full. however the bottom octaves ar a bit rolled off, and speakers will need to be decent efficency. i ran 86dbl fronts up to about half volume on the sonic impact before distortiion became noticable. it was loud, but if van halens jump came on you'd definately want more juice than it can give. does that make sense? anyway sound dynamics rts-3's are a bookshelf speaker. the company is now called athena and the bookshelves under that name are similar in build and price. i have not heard them however, but they are supposed to be as good as the original. oh
